Software vs. Hardware

Difference Between Software and Hardware   Computer Hardware comprises the physical form and parts of a computer that actually…

Difference Between Software and Hardware


Computer Hardware comprises the physical form and parts of a computer that actually perform the data processing. These include the memory disks, peripheral devices and central processing unit. Software on the other hand is the set of instructions and codes that control all functions of the hardware, direct operations and all other related tasks. Examples of software include your internet browsers and the operating system Microsoft Windows. Both software and hardware are required for a computer to work.

Software and hardware are integral parts not just of computers, but of all other electronic devices such as cellular phones, iPods, and even satellite systems as well. They work together as a team in order to make these devices work. The physical form of the computer and these other devices is what we call hardware, while the programs that make them function are the software.




All the computer components that we can actually see and touch are part of its hardware. Whether it’s inside the computer or outside, all are hardware as long as they actually exist and can be perceived by our senses. These often include the components that lie on the motherboard, the hard drives, RAMs, processors, CDs or DVDs, power supply, data cables, and peripheral devices like the mouse and keyboard. Without your computer hardware, you’d have no computer at all.



In order to make your computer do what it’s supposed to, you will need software. Software and hardware work hand in hand to make your computer or digital device functional. It is the software that tells the hardware what to do and how to do it. Software or programs that command the hardware include operating systems like Microsoft, Macintosh, and Linux, and application programs like MS Office, Word and all the other applications that you usually use in a computer. You can think of software as the computer’s brain and the hardware as its body.

Differentiating Between the Two


Hardware will only function if software is already installed. On the other hand, software will not have anything to do its bidding and perform its instructions if there’s no hardware. Hardware components may also not matter whatever the software is. Most hardware can accommodate numerous, if not all, varieties of software.

The physical storage disk is part of the hardware, but the data stored in it is categorized as software. You can’t touch that data or see it cramped inside the memory disk just like all other software. Software is not tangible, unless you’re viewing it on your computer monitor. Hardware in the other hand is very tangible. The memory disk where the stored data are supposed to be is as solid as it gets.

Technological advancement also favors software. It’s like every year, a new version of your operating system comes out and almost every day you get new updates on your current OS. Companies that make OS are competing with each other, copying some, getting ahead some. Hardware advancements, on the other hand, are quite slower. It takes time to change your processor’s specifications or come up with a new hard drive that packs a larger storage capacity.

Bottom Line


The computer’s physical and tangible appearance comprises its hardware, while the software is the set of instructions that guide the hardware in performing its tasks. The two must be compatible with each other and despite their vast differences; both software and hardware are required in order for your computer to function properly.

Leave a Reply

Your email address will not be published. Required fields are marked *

Related Posts

Facts vs. Truths

Do you know the difference between facts and truths? Fact and truth seem to be the same thing,…

Full HD vs. HD Ready

Difference Between Full HD and HD Ready   Screens that are HD ready have a mere 1366×768 pixel…

Mouse vs. Hamster

Difference Between Mouse And Hamster Mouse, a name applied to many varieties of small rodents, particularly those in…